I guess you guys don't know how toys are made.
Yes they are all hand painted, but the cheaper ones (and yes, for under $200 they are cheap,or average these days) are done in a factory by factory workers.
The handpainted 100 day war version are painted up by the main guy in his workshop, who is widely regarded as one of the best 1/6th customizers working. So his paintjob will be miles better than some asian teenager who was taught how to paint the figures a week ago.
